foreach($arr as $key = $item){ //foreach 遍历数组$key 是键值,$item 是元素值。
日喀则网站建设公司创新互联,日喀则网站设计制作,有大型网站制作公司丰富经验。已为日喀则1000+提供企业网站建设服务。企业网站搭建\外贸网站制作要多少钱,请找那个售后服务好的日喀则做网站的公司定做!
第foreach()foreach()是一个用来遍历数组中数据的最简单有效的方法。
注:foreach只能用于数组 第一种格式遍历给定数组$array,每次循环,当前单元的值被赋给 $value 并且数组内部的指针向前移一步(下一次循环中将会得到下一个单元)。
在test.php文件内,使用array_values()方法将上一步的数据重新排序,并且从0开始,把重新排序的数组保存在$result变量中。在test.php文件内,使用foreach方法遍历数组,其中$k为索引值,$v为索引值对应的数组值。
这样根节点会有总数的记录。这样递归遍历时也可以根据子节点数量c的来确定读取的数量限制。比如 读取条数计数10 就继续递归 在每个节点的表上 增加子节点的id集或计数,增加根节点到父节点路径,会方便这些操作。
首先你要说你用的是什么数据库。用最普通的mysql数据库来说,php自带了一些操作数据库的函数。
1、每个节点都要记录子节点的数量c。每新增一个节点都要对各父和祖节点的子节点计数加1。这样根节点会有总数的记录。这样递归遍历时也可以根据子节点数量c的来确定读取的数量限制。
2、?php 这将生成一个2维数组。你执行完就能看到这个数组的结构。
3、简单的循环即可,选出重复(出现次数大于等于2)的元素并统计每个重复元素出现的次数:php中的 array_count_values() 函数可以实现 array_count_values() 函数用于统计数组中所有值出现的次数。
4、result=mysql_query($sql);num=mysql_num_rows($result); //$num就是总数。
5、能表述清楚点嘛?统计数量简单得很啊,如果一个空格表示一个单词的分割。第一步:用空格分割字符串并赋值给数组。第二步:去掉数组中的空值和无效值。第三步:统计数组大小。如果不严谨的统计,第二步可以省略。
6、我们要统计在一段时间内访问站点的人数,有多种解决方案,你可以使用cookie,session结合文本或者数据库来记录用户访问数。本文将使用PHP,结合Mysql以及jQuery,展示一个统计在线人数以及访客地区分布的示例。
首先新建一个test表,有id,name,second三个字段,其中name字段有重复数据。输入“select name,max(second) from test group by name”语句,点击运行。可以看到已经查询出按name分组后取出的second最大的一条记录。
首先,打开php编辑器,新建php文件,例如:index.php。
query($sql,$conn);//对结果进行判断 if(mysql_num_rows( $query)){ rs=mysql_fetch_array($query);//统计结果 count=$rs[0];}else{ count=0;} echo $count;? 返回的$count就是当前数据库的记录条数。